Post by kunkel321 »

Again with the missing icon images in xy and in Win Exp...

After posting, I remembered that I learned a workaround a long time ago: Get the old beta version of Real World Icon Editor, go to Preferences > File associations. Then let RWIE be associated with Windows Icons. After doing that, they appear correctly:
https://app.screencast.com/0hMGvAloLiBSv

Note that RWIE is not free. There might be a trial version(?)

Re: Custom File Icons not working?

Post by highend »

Then the problem with your old definitions is: the space before your <xyicons> (which you don't need anyway because that's the default path)
